Question WT Fiesta and 17 inch rims

I am getting a new WT Zetec Hatch in a few weeks and looking at fitting a set of 17's. I have done a search and most, if not all of the info re offsets/tyre sizes etc. relates to the German built models with a PCD of 4X108 - does anyone know if the details below (cut&paste from an older thread) would apply to my Thai built model?
''You need 17" wheels ...... with an offset of ET40 matched to 205/40R17 tyres''
I plan on going past a few tyre shops, but I thought it was best to do a bit of research before hand.

Hmmmm... Euro Fiesta and the Thai-built Fiesta wheels...

Euro Fiesta: 6 x 15", offset 47.5
Euro Fiesta: 6.5 x 16", offset 41.5
Thai-built Asia-Pacific Fiesta: 6 x 15", offset ---I have no data---
Thai-built Asia-Pacific Fiesta: 6 x 16", offset 47.5

The WP, WQ and WS (euro) Fiestas including the XR4 (ST) have a pcd of 4x108.

Its the new Thai-made 2011 WT Fiesta that has the 4x100 pcd wheels/hubs.
